Sassuolo boss Roberto De Zerbi shrugs off injury crisis ahead of Roma clash: “We will still play our football.”

Sassuolo boss Roberto De Zerbi shrugged off injury concerns as he discussed tomorrow’s fixture against Roma.

The Neroverdi host the Giallorossi tomorrow at the Mapei Stadium, however, both sides will be without a number of key players.

Sassuolo will be missing a number of first choice options including: Domenico Berardi, Gian Marco Ferrari, Francesco Caputo, Manuel Locatelli, Mert Müldür, Kaan Ayhan, and Gregoire Defrel.

“We still have a very good team available tomorrow. There’s Toljan, Traoré, Boga, Raspadori, Djuricic, Maxime Lopez, Magnanelli, Peluso, Chiriches, Marlon, Rogerio, and Kyriakopoulos,” stated De Zerbi.

“We will still play our football like we always do, regardless of the opponent, but Roma are a great team that we respect. They play well and have a strong identity and quality players, like Sassuolo. The fact that both teams have several players within their national teams is proof of the quality.”

He concluded, “I expect an open match. We’ll be facing a courageous team that likes to play. However, I want us to focus on ourselves. We’ll have eleven players on the pitch tomorrow that are worthy of Sassuolo.”
